Tokyo, Japan

To visit Tokyo is to be transported to a mesmerizing metropolis that mixes ancient tradition with postmodern culture. One of the world's great cities, this thriving locale offers a virtually unlimited choice of shopping, entertainment, culture and dining for those who visit, in addition to its many excellent museums, historic temples and gardens.

Points North… and West

North from Japan lies the Russian port town of Korsakov, which was once ruled by Japan from 1905 to 1945 and shows its Japanese lineage. South Korea's second-most populated metropolis of Busan is a relaxing seaport traversed by travelers the world over.
